WebTexas Hurricane Risk Zones. Metadata Updated: January 13, 2024. This layer is derived from the Texas A and M / DEM Risk Area maps. Risk area zones (1 - 5 ) are identified by hurricane categories. Area 1 corresponds to a Category 1 Hurricane. For a Category 3 hurricane, risk areas 1,2, and 3 would be threatened. WebA high velocity hurricane zone is an area of South Florida that has been designated by the state to be more prone to severe weather and hurricanes than any other area in the state. Out of the 67 counties in Florida, only two of them are considered to be in a high velocity hurricane zone and those counties are Broward and Miami-Dade. ...
